OCaml

Results: 348



#Item
201SPIN model checker / OCaml / Model checking / Application programming interfaces / Secure Shell / Promela / Assertion / Type system / C / Computing / Software / Model checkers

SPLAT: A Tool for Model-Checking and Dynamically-Enforcing Abstractions Anil Madhavapeddy1 , David Scott2 , and Richard Sharp3 1 Computer Laboratory, University of Cambridge

Add to Reading List

Source URL: anil.recoil.org

Language: English - Date: 2013-09-29 14:14:18
202Compiler construction / Cross-platform software / Functional languages / OCaml / Bytecode / Compiler / Preprocessor / Compiled language / Interpreter / Computing / Software / Programming language implementation

Part II Development Tools 193

Add to Reading List

Source URL: caml.inria.fr

Language: English - Date: 2011-11-23 02:41:37
203Functional languages / Data types / Type theory / Source code / Holism / Type system / OCaml / Abstract data type / Caml / Software engineering / Computer programming / Computing

Part III Application Structure 401

Add to Reading List

Source URL: caml.inria.fr

Language: English - Date: 2011-11-23 02:41:37
204Functional languages / Procedural programming languages / OCaml / Caml / ML / Declaration / Objective-C / Printf format string / C / Software engineering / Computing / Computer programming

12 Interoperability with C Developing programs in a given language very often requires one to integrate libraries written in other languages. The two main reasons for this are: •

Add to Reading List

Source URL: caml.inria.fr

Language: English - Date: 2011-11-23 02:41:37
205Debuggers / Debugging / GNU Debugger / Computer errors / Strace / OCaml / Core dump / Gdbserver / Computer programming / Computing / Software

Real-world debugging in OCaml Mark Shinwell Jane Street Europe OCaml Users and Developers Workshop 2012

Add to Reading List

Source URL: oud.ocaml.org

Language: English - Date: 2012-09-26 17:36:02
206Functional languages / OCaml / Caml / Xen / ML / Foreach loop / Citrix Systems / Monad / Structural type system / Computing / Software engineering / Computer programming

Using Functional Programming within an Industrial Product Group: Perspectives and Perceptions David Scott Richard Sharp

Add to Reading List

Source URL: anil.recoil.org

Language: English - Date: 2013-09-29 14:14:18
207Functional languages / Programming paradigms / OCaml / Caml / ML / Functional programming / Objective-C / Conditional / Object-oriented programming / Software engineering / Computer programming / Computing

Conclusion Although computer science has become an industrial activity, in many respects the success of a programming language is a subjective affair. If “the heart has its reasons of which reason knows nothing,” the

Add to Reading List

Source URL: caml.inria.fr

Language: English - Date: 2011-11-23 02:41:37
208Type theory / Functional languages / Data types / OCaml / Functional programming / ML / Caml / Type system / Type safety / Software engineering / Computing / Programming language theory

Replace this file with prentcsmacro.sty for your meeting, or with entcsmacro.sty for your meeting. Both can be found at the ENTCS Macro Home Page. Dynamics for ML using Meta-Programming Thomas Gazagnaire

Add to Reading List

Source URL: anil.recoil.org

Language: English - Date: 2013-09-29 14:14:18
209Object-oriented programming / OCaml / Caml / Coupling / Comparison of programming languages / Preprocessor / Information hiding / Perl module / Software engineering / Computing / Computer programming

The OCaml system release 3.12 Documentation and user’s manual Xavier Leroy, Damien Doligez, Alain Frisch, Jacques Garrigue, Didier R´emy and J´erˆome Vouillon

Add to Reading List

Source URL: caml.inria.fr

Language: English - Date: 2011-07-29 09:33:47
210Data types / C++ Standard Library / Functional languages / Procedural programming languages / Object-oriented programming / Sequence container / ALGOL 68 / OCaml / Fold / Computing / Software engineering / Computer programming

8 Libraries Every language comes with collections of programs that are reusable by the programmer, called libraries. The quality and diversity of these programs are often some of the criteria one uses to assess the ease

Add to Reading List

Source URL: caml.inria.fr

Language: English - Date: 2011-11-23 02:41:37
UPDATE